We’re less than a month away from Samsung’s Galaxy Unpacked event, and leaks regarding the Galaxy S26 series continue to emerge. The latest information pairs key specifications of the S26 Ultra with additional official renders of the device in Cobalt Violet and Black hues. A detailed spec sheet shared by AndroidHeadlines covers nearly every aspect of Samsung’s upcoming flagship.

The Galaxy S26 Ultra is expected to feature a 6.9-inch Dynamic AMOLED display with QHD+ resolution and a refreshing rate of 1-120Hz. The display will include a new Privacy Display feature, which limits visibility from side angles. Additionally, it will come equipped with a 12MP front-facing camera and support for the S Pen.

In terms of dimensions, the S26 Ultra is anticipated to measure 163.6 x 78.1 x 7.9 mm and weigh 214 grams. This is nearly identical to the S25 Ultra’s dimensions of 162.8 x 77.6 x 8.2 mm and weight of 218 grams.

Samsung is likely to equip the S26 Ultra with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 chip, although it remains unclear if this will be a “for Galaxy” version like previous S-series models. The phone will be offered with a base storage capacity of 256GB, expandable up to 1TB.

The rear of the device will feature a newly designed camera module, including a 200MP main shooter (ISOCELL HP2) rumored to possess an f/1.4 aperture for improved low-light performance. This will be accompanied by a 50MP ultrawide lens (Samsung JN3), a 50MP periscope telephoto lens (IMX854), and a 12MP telephoto lens (Samsung S5K3LD).

Those looking for an increase in battery capacity may be disappointed, as the S26 Ultra is expected to include a 5,000mAh battery. Although this latest leak does not specify charging speeds, previous reports suggest that Samsung might increase the charging speed to 60W, up from 45W seen with the S25 Ultra.

Samsung is slated to announce the S26 series on February 25, with pre-sales beginning on March 5 and general availability rumored for March 11.
